The main functions of thermal imaging cameras

Thermal imaging cameras are mainly used in R&D or industrial inspection and equipment maintenance. They are also widely used in fire protection, night vision and security. The functions of thermal imaging cameras include: non-contact temperature measurement, real-time monitoring, detection and diagnosis, security monitoring, environmental monitoring, etc.
1. Non-contact temperature measurement
The thermal imager can measure the temperature of the surface of an object non-contactly through infrared technology without contact with the object being measured. Therefore, it can measure objects in high temperature, low temperature or dangerous environments to ensure the safety of personnel.
2. Real-time monitoring
Thermal imaging cameras can capture and display the temperature distribution on the surface of objects in real-time mode, which is very useful for some applications that require timely monitoring of temperature changes, such as industrial production, medical diagnosis, fire rescue, etc.
3. Detection and diagnosis
Thermal imaging cameras can detect and diagnose the temperature distribution on the surface of objects, and can be used for fault diagnosis, quality control, defect detection and other applications, such as detecting heat leaks in buildings, hot spots in circuits, etc.
4. Security monitoring
Thermal imaging cameras can monitor temperature changes on the surface of objects at night or in low-light environments, and are used for security monitoring, warning and prevention, such as monitoring fire, smoke, personnel intrusion, etc.
5. Environmental monitoring
Thermal imaging cameras can be used to monitor the temperature distribution in the environment, such as detecting the temperature distribution of air conditioners and heating equipment, the water temperature in water pipes, etc.
